Auf der Suche nach einer genauen Wiedergabe-FPS von einem Video

Ich habe mit After Effects ein 1080P-Video erstellt, und nachdem es gerendert wurde, ruckelt die Wiedergabe etwas. Jetzt bin ich mir ziemlich sicher, dass dieses Stottern darauf zurückzuführen ist, dass der Computer mit der Wiedergabe zu kämpfen hat, aber ich muss das beweisen können.

Ich hatte irgendwie gehofft, dass VLC eine Möglichkeit hat, die FPS des abgespielten Videos anzuzeigen, aber soweit ich das beurteilen kann, hat es so etwas nicht (zeigt nur die FPS des Renderings an).

Kann mir jemand eine Software empfehlen, die mir die Wiedergabe-FPS eines Videos liefert?

Danke vielmals!

In welchen Codec hast du gerendert? Könnten Sie vielleicht etwas rendern, das sich etwas einfacher wiedergeben lässt?

Antworten (3)

Ich persönlich benutze Fraps. Der einzige Grund, warum ich Fraps verwende, ist, dass ich früher tonnenweise Desktop-Aufnahmen gemacht habe. Wenn Sie jedoch die kostenlose Version von Fraps erhalten, sollten Sie damit die Framerate des wiedergegebenen Videos sehen können, während das Programm geöffnet ist.

Gibt dies nicht die Bildrate für den gesamten Bildschirm an und nicht nur für das Video, das abgespielt wird? (sorry falls blöde frage!)
Keine Sorge, Jimmy! Fraps analysiert bestimmte Fenster mit aktualisierten Bildern. Zum Beispiel können Fraps gleichzeitig die FPS eines Programms (wie eines Videospiels), das Sie geöffnet haben, und eines Films, den Sie auf Ihrem PC spielen, anzeigen. Sie sind einzigartig und spezifisch für die Anwendung. Der FPS-Zähler wird in der oberen rechten Ecke der Anwendung angezeigt, um Verwirrung zu vermeiden. „[Angeben] der Bildrate für den gesamten Bildschirm“ ist nicht unbedingt sinnvoll, insbesondere wenn man bedenkt, dass Teile des Bildschirms nur Bilder (wie ein Desktop-Hintergrund) und keine bewegten Bilder sind.
Beachten Sie, dass dies die Häufigkeit angibt, mit der der Videoplayer das Fenster pro Sekunde aktualisiert, nicht unbedingt die Bildrate der Videowiedergabe, aber es sollte wahrscheinlich immer noch eine aussagekräftige Information für Ihre Zwecke sein.
@AJHenderson Ich arbeite auf einem 120Hz-Monitor und kann im Vertrauen sagen, dass mein Ergebnis oft nicht 120 ist, wenn ich Fraps verwende. Wenn ich Filme schaue, ist es 24, wenn ich Spiele spiele, ist es das, was mein PC aufbringen kann. Wollen Sie damit sagen, dass Fraps auf die Bildwiederholfrequenz beschränkt ist? Das würde Sinn machen. Es wird jedoch nicht die Bildwiederholfrequenz, sondern die Bildrate der Anwendung gemeldet, es sei denn, ich verstehe etwas falsch.
@ScottJamesWalter - FRAPS meldet die Anzahl der Aktualisierungsaufrufe, die von der Anwendung an den Videopuffer gesendet werden. Bei einem Spiel tritt dies jedes Mal auf, wenn das Spiel einen Frame rendert, bei einem Videoplayer kann dies einmal pro Frame oder mehrmals pro Frame auftreten, wenn der Videoplayer eine Art Interpolation durchführt oder einen Frame sendet pünktlich, unabhängig davon, ob das Decodieren des nächsten Frames abgeschlossen ist. Es kommt darauf an, wie sich der Spieler verhält. Es ist wahrscheinlich immer noch ein ziemlich genauer Ansatz für die meisten Spieler, aber es ist nicht vollständig fehlersicher.
In beiden Fällen ist die Zahl in diesem Fall wahrscheinlich niedriger als die tatsächlichen FPS des Videos, was ihren Verdacht immer noch bestätigen würde, aber selbst eine höhere Zahl oder die gleiche Zahl wie die Videobildrate kann dies nicht ausschließen.

Sie können versuchen, in ein Format mit geringerer Qualität umzucodieren, das sich einfacher wiedergeben lässt. Wenn das Video selbst stottert, stottert die niedrigere Qualität immer noch auf die gleiche Weise. Wenn Sie durch Ihre Wiedergabegeschwindigkeit eingeschränkt sind, sollte die Version mit niedrigerer Qualität reibungslos abgespielt werden. Wenn es bei geringerer Qualität flüssig abgespielt wird, wissen Sie, dass die Originaldatei gut ist.

Manchmal können Videos direkt aus After Effects langsam oder „stotternd“ sein. Ich habe festgestellt, dass das Einbringen des Videos in Premiere Pro und das Exportieren aus Premiere (im Wesentlichen das erneute Rendern des Videos in Premiere) dabei erheblich helfen kann.